Cleanrooms (dust-free workshops) have extremely strict requirements for ground cleanliness—any dust, oil stains, or debris may affect product quality, violate industry cleanliness standards, and even cause production accidents. Unlike ordinary factory workshops, Dust-free workshops floor is prone to hidden troubles such as machine oil stains, metal filings, and fine dust accumulation, while requiring strict protection of the floor’s wear-resistant and anti-static layers (common in epoxy, emery, and oil-resistant industrial floors). Conventional cleaning tools have obvious drawbacks: ordinary scrub pads cannot capture fine dust and metal filings, chemical cleaners leave residues that fail to meet cleanliness standards and may corrode floor layers, and inefficient cleaning affects production progress.
